Frequently asked questions

About Centre Elementary School
How many students attend Centre Elementary School?
Centre Elementary School enrolls approximately 647 students in grades PK-04.
What age range does Centre Elementary School serve?
Centre Elementary School serves students from grade PK through grade 04.
How many students per teacher at Centre Elementary School?
Approximately 16.2:1 students per teacher at Centre Elementary School.
What is the student diversity at Centre Elementary School?
Student demographics at Centre Elementary School are roughly 85% White, 3% Hispanic, 8% Black, 0% Asian, 4% Two or more.
